leonarski_f 0220c6376d cmake: fetch libtiff and FFTW instead of relying on system libs
Both are leaf deps (JFJochPreview / JFJochIndexing) that only our own code
looks for, so building them ourselves removes the system-package lottery and
gives a reproducible, statically-linked build on every platform.

- libtiff: FetchContent, library only (jbig/zstd/lzma/jpeg/old-jpeg/tools/
  tests off). The C++ binding (TIFF::CXX / libtiffxx) is packaged
  inconsistently across distros -- missing on Rocky 9 -- and absent on
  Windows, so find_package(TIFF COMPONENTS CXX) was unreliable; that call is
  removed and JFJochPreview links the tiff/tiffxx targets directly. GitHub
  mirror because upstream (gitlab) is unreachable from some restricted hosts.
- FFTW: FetchContent single precision (ENABLE_FLOAT) from the release tarball
  -- the git repo ships no pre-generated codelets (needs OCaml genfft). It's
  now always available, so the CPU FFT indexer is always built and
  JFJOCH_USE_FFTW always defined; the "FFTW disabled" path is gone. Static
  (libfftw3f.a) via the global BUILD_SHARED_LIBS OFF.

Verified on Linux: jfjoch_viewer builds and links libfftw3f.a + libtiff*.a,
all static.
